What does EEr mean?
This fault is triggered by an external safety circuit or monitoring device connected to the drive, indicating a condition outside the drive itself requires attention. By default, this critical condition triggers a full TRIP, inhibiting all ignition pulses and resetting the Ready signal, as it typically signifies an important external protective function has been activated. Manual reset is required.
Complete Troubleshooting Guide
- 1
Identify external fault source: Check any external devices or safety circuits connected to the drive's external fault input (e.g., overtravel limit switches, emergency stops, external contactors).
- 2
Inspect external wiring: Verify all connections to the external fault input terminals on the drive for proper wiring and continuity.
- 3
Reset external devices: Ensure any tripped external protective devices are reset.
- 4
Bypass for testing (if safe and authorized): Temporarily bypass the external fault input (only for troubleshooting, with caution) to determine if the drive operates without the external circuit.
- 5
Review external fault configuration: Confirm the drive's parameter for external fault input (e.g., normally open/closed) is correct.
